| (Millions of dollars except share and per share amounts) | Three Months Ended / April 4, 2026 | Three Months Ended / March 29, 2025 |
|---|---|---|
| Operating income | 96 | 38 |
| Interest expense | (10) | (10) |
| Income from affiliates | 42 | 13 |
| Other income (loss), net | 15 | (1) |
| Earnings before income taxes | 143 | 40 |
| Income tax expense | (23) | (8) |
| Net earnings | $120 | $32 |
| Less: Net earnings attributable to noncontrolling interests | (1) | — |

- What is Seaboard's other income (expense)?
- Seaboard (SEB) reported other income (expense) of $15M in Q1 2026.
- How has Seaboard's other income (expense) changed year-over-year?
- Seaboard's other income (expense) increased by 1600.0% year-over-year, from -$1M to $15M.
- What is the long-term trend for Seaboard's other income (expense)?
- Over 3 years (2021 to 2025), Seaboard's other income (expense) has grown at a -16.7% compound annual growth rate (CAGR), from $178M to $103M.
- What does other income (expense) mean?
- Net total of all non-operating income and expenses not classified in specific line items — a catch-all for miscellaneous financial items.
